About UWC

The University of the Western Cape (UWC) is a respected institution dedicated to providing accessible, high-quality higher education. It offers a wide range of academic programs across various fields and is recognized for its strong focus on impactful research addressing both local and global issues. UWC’s vibrant campus fosters community engagement and leadership development among students, faculty, and staff. Through its innovative teaching methods and research, the university plays a vital role in advancing knowledge and driving positive societal change at both regional and international levels.
